#319f30 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#319f30 is composed of 19.2% red, 62.4%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.8%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 119.5 degrees, a saturation of 53.6% and a lightness of 40.6%. #319f30 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ff60 with #003f00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#319f30 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#319f30 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#319f30 has RGB values of R:49, G:159,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 3252016.

Shades and Tints of #319f30
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030803 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#319f30
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606f60 is the less saturated color, while #02cf00 is the most saturated one.
